Camp Doha was the main U.S. Army base in Kuwait, and played a pivotal role in the U.S. military presence in the Middle East since the 1991 Gulf War and in the 2003 invasion of Iraq. The complex is located on a small peninsula on Kuwait Bay, west of Kuwait City. It was initially a large industrial warehouse complex and was taken in hand by the U.S. Army for conversion to its current role in 1998 during Operation Desert Thunder.

  • Camp Doha ist ein ehemaliges Freihafengelände, nordwestlich an Kuwait angrenzend, direkt am Persischen Golf gelegen. Es umfasst eine Fläche von ca. 2 × 3 km. Es dient seit dem Zweiten Golfkrieg (1991) als zentrale logistische Basis der US-amerikanischen Streitkräfte im Bereich des Nahen Ostens. Ab Anfang 2002 beherbergte Camp Doha den Stab und einige Kräfte der Combined Joint Task Force (CJTF CM), einem multinationaler Einsatzverband unter US-amerikanischem Kommando. Auch das zur CJTF CM gehörige deutsche ABC-Abwehrbataillon Kuwait war von Februar 2002 bis Juni 2003 in Camp Doha stationiert. Während des Irak-Krieges im März/April 2003 diente Camp Doha dem zuständigen amerikanischen Regionalkommando (US Central Command/USCENTCOM) als logistische Drehscheibe und Quartier operativer Kommandozentralen (Joint Operation Center): Coalition Forces Land Component Command (CFLCC).
